This week’s focus on bills of big impact that might become law relates to preparing for the ever-growing role of technology in financial services. Texas has in recent years been a national leader in creating legal structure for things like remote on-line notaries led by TMBA General Counsel John Fleming. The three bills highlighted here, all sponsored by PIFS Vice Chair Rep. Tan Parker, seek to maintain this leadership role.

This evening Governor Abbott will deliver his State of the State Address. In this speech he can name emergency items making those issues the sole areas the legislature is allow to pass bills on within the first 60 days of the session. Governor Abbott’s recent comments might hint at funding protections for law enforcement and liability protections for businesses concerning COVID-19 as emergency items on his agenda.
